Job Description

Skills

  • Proven expertise in JavaScript (ES6+) , along with HTML , CSS , and jQuery
  • Strong understanding of object-oriented analysis , software design patterns , and modular design
  • Experience in building responsive , single-page applications (SPA)
  • Hands‑on experience with CSS preprocessors such as LESS and SASS
  • Familiarity with UI libraries like Bootstrap and Vuetify (a plus)
  • Experience developing with Node.js and integrating with frontend frameworks
  • Exposure to Docker for developing, running, and delivering applications
  • Solid understanding of localization and internationalization in UI development
  • Familiarity with NuxtJS or NextJS is highly desirable
  • Strong grasp of advanced JavaScript concepts such as event loop , p...

Apply for this Position

Ready to join Career Maker Bahrain? Click the button below to submit your application.

Submit Application